The antibody against RNF150 was raised in Rabbit using the recombinant fusion protein containing a sequence corresponding to amino acids 92-211 of human RNF150 (NP_065775.1) as the immunogen. The polyclonal antibody exists as a isotype IgG, by affinity purification. This antibody has been validated on WB, ELISA.

Target Full Name
RING finger protein 150
Target Subcellular Location
Membrane; Single-pass type I membrane protein.
Target Synonyms
RNF150; KIAA1214; RING finger protein 150
Target Background
Predicted to enable ubiquitin protein ligase activity. Predicted to be involved in ubiquitin-dependent protein catabolic process. Predicted to be integral component of membrane. Predicted to be active in cytoplasm.
